    Description by mibdepot

    The next available Virtual Router Id (index).
    This object provides a hint for the rcVrfId value
    to use when administratively creating a new
    rcVrfConfigEntry.

    A GET of this object returns the next available rcVrfId
    value to be used to create an entry in the associated
    rcVrfConfigTable; or zero, if no valid rcVrfId
    value is available. A value of zero(0) indicates that
    it is not possible to create a new rcVrfConfigEntry.
    This object also returns a value of zero when it is the
    lexicographic successor of a varbind presented in an
    SNMP GETNEXT or GETBULK request, for which circumstance
    it is assumed that ifIndex allocation is unintended.

    Successive GETs will typically return different
    values, thus avoiding collisions among cooperating
    management clients seeking to create table entries
    simultaneously.

    Unless specified otherwise by its MAX-ACCESS and
    DESCRIPTION clauses, an object of this type is read-only,
    and a SET of such an object returns a notWritable error.
